Tech leader Roborock is expanding its smart home ecosystem to outdoor spaces, introducing an advanced robotic lawn mower to US markets. The new RockMow X1 LiDAR combines sophisticated navigation technology with eco-friendly yard care, promising to give homeowners more free time while maintaining beautiful lawns.

The RockMow X1 LiDAR represents Roborock's thoughtful expansion into outdoor robotics, giving Americans access to the same advanced lawn care technology that has already been transforming yards internationally.

What makes this robotic helper so special? It's equipped with impressive autonomous navigation capabilities that combine LiDAR and Visual Simultaneous Localization and Mapping technology. In simpler terms, this smart mower can "see" and understand your yard in three dimensions, navigating around obstacles and creating efficient mowing patterns all on its own. No boundary wires needed—just let it learn your lawn and watch it work its magic.

The all-wheel drive system means this capable machine can handle challenging terrain with ease, conquering slopes up to 80 percent and climbing over obstacles as tall as 3.1 inches. Whether your yard has hills, garden borders, or uneven ground, the RockMow X1 LiDAR is designed to take it all in stride.

For typical American homeowners, the mower's capacity to handle up to half an acre per day is perfectly suited to suburban lawns. Imagine waking up to a freshly manicured yard without lifting a finger—it's not a dream anymore, it's the reality of smart home technology working for you.

Beyond the convenience factor, robotic mowers like the RockMow X1 LiDAR offer environmental benefits too. They're electric-powered, meaning zero emissions while operating, and they can help maintain healthier lawns through more frequent, consistent cutting that traditional weekly mowing can't match.
